What is Power BI?

Power BI is an AI tool in the AI BI & Analytics Tools category. Microsoft's BI platform with Copilot-driven natural-language analysis. AI-assisted business intelligence platforms with natural-language data queries.

Teams typically bring in a tool like Power BI when a broader platform's built-in version of this workflow isn't specific enough for what they need, rather than as a wholesale replacement for their existing stack — it gets adopted as a focused point solution and plugged in alongside whatever CRM, data, or workflow tools a team already runs. Concretely, that means copilot can draft DAX measures and summarize report insights in plain language, and tightly integrated with Excel, Teams, and the rest of Microsoft 365. Where a point solution like Power BI breaks

  • Natural-language query tools answer the question you ask — they don't know which question matters or catch a broken upstream pipeline
  • They assume clean, well-modeled data; most teams' data isn't clean or well-modeled
  • Dashboards accumulate faster than anyone reads them, and nobody owns fixing the pipeline underneath
